In many web browsers, if you enter a URL with "whitespace"
type chars at the end, the browser automatically ignores
it.  Konqueror differs:

If you try to access a URL such as http://bugs.kde.org%20 
konqueror reports "Unknown host".  

This occurs typically when one is selecting a URL in a
Konsole window and accidentally also highlight to the end
of the line.  Klipper recognizes this as a URL and pops up
to prompt for loading into Konqueror, so it would be nice
if Konqueror would automatically ignore the extra whitespace/EOL's.
